About Benjamin Shirley
Biography
Ben is a dedicated Physician Assistant in the Department of Urology at the University of Alabama at Birmingham (UAB) Hospital. He specializes in providing comprehensive inpatient care to patients with complex urologic conditions, including urologic cancers, kidney stones, prostate disorders, bladder dysfunction, urinary tract infections, and post-operative management.
Ben works closely with the urology attending physicians, residents, and multidisciplinary team to deliver high-quality, compassionate care on the inpatient service. His responsibilities include daily rounding, managing acute urologic issues, coordinating care plans, performing bedside procedures, and ensuring smooth transitions from the operating room to recovery and discharge.
Ben earned his Master of Science in Physician Assistant Studies from Lincoln Memorial University in Harrogate, TN. He is certified by the National Commission on Certification of Physician Assistants (NCCPA) and holds active licensure in the state of Alabama.
